Robert Chester's 'Love's Martyr; Or, Rosalins Complaint'

In 1878, literary scholar Alexander Balloch Grosart (1827-99) reprinted this allegorical poem by Robert Chester (fl.c.1586-1604), who probably served as chaplain or secretary to Sir John Salusbury. Originally printed in 1601, the work is better known for its appended original poems by Shakespeare, Jonson, Chapman and Marston.
